Output 3cfce579cea30234c7467e850cdfdde13175526524bf63f26d865f7ebe9acfa0:27

value
26628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a99250fe1c685fbd31248a78e0d9fc884d67c19 OP_EQUAL
address
39x4CVbkK4HDvMHmK1vMoZqCeCnqNELB3Z
transaction
3cfce579cea30234c7467e850cdfdde13175526524bf63f26d865f7ebe9acfa0
spent
true